Wheat price
Next week’s indicator price to wheat growers has risen $2.28 a tonne to $198.95, according to Aratex Management in association with United Wheatgrowers. The rising value of the Kiwi dollar against United States currency has prevented the full benefits from a lift in the A.S.W. price being passed to New Zealand growers.
